Hi,

Does anyone know or can look up the size of the bolts which fix the genuine roof rack to a ph.1 3dr? I'd imagine they're the same for all roof racks but still. I did have the bolts but they've escaped the tape that held them to the rack in storage...

As I've never had a roof rack on the car I'm not entirely certain which bolts you're talking about.  Could they be the M6 x 1 x 12mm ones in the schematic below?

Definitely get the button head and make sure that the thread on the roof is clear. Ive got one stuck half way before which meant i couldnt close the door :/
Reply
Thanks given by:
#10
agreed! a fine-pitch tap should clear the threads of paint & corrosion.
follow with a good dollop of copper grease before using.
